vagrant: ошибка при получении данных хранилища для базы C7.6.1810, хранилище не найдено - PullRequest
0 голосов
/ 10 января 2019

Я выполняю следующие шаги для создания мезо -

https://dcos -e2e-cli.readthedocs.io / ен / последний / DCOS-бродяга-cli.html

когда я запускаю команду minidcos vagrant create ./dcos_generate_config.sh --agents 0 я получаю ошибку ниже.

Error getting repository data for C7.6.1810-base, repository not found
==> dcos-e2e-918351cd-9d88-47c6-9b72-b2f5194302fc-master-0: Checking for guest additions in VM...
Error creating cluster.
Try "minidcos vagrant doctor" for troubleshooting help.

Как устранить эту ошибку?

Ответы [ 3 ]

0 голосов
/ 27 января 2019

Появилась новая версия vagrant-vbguest, которая исправляет проблему (0.17.2). Существует также новая версия minidcos, которая включает проверку врачом, что по крайней мере эта версия установлена.

0 голосов
/ 27 января 2019

В настоящее время существует новая версия vagrant-vbguest, которая устраняет проблему (0.17.2), а также есть новая версия minidcos, которая включает проверку врачом, что по крайней мере эта версия установлена.

0 голосов
/ 18 января 2019

Как предложил Тим Харпер в комментарии, я обновил файл ~/.vagrant.d/gems/2.4.2/gems/vagrant-vbguest-0.17.1/lib/vagrant-vbguest/installers/centos.rb.

В этом файле я закомментировал

# cmd = "yum install -y kernel-devel- uname -r --enablerepo=C#{rel}-base --enablerepo=C#{rel}-updates"

и добавлено cmd = "yum install -y kernel-devel- uname -r --enablerepo=C*-base --enablerepo=C*-updates".

Тогда это сработало.

...